Subject: Partner SFTP drop — new owner

Hi,

As you review the pending changes to the Harborline ingest scripts, note that ownership of the partner SFTP drop is changing at the end of the month. This includes key rotation, the nightly pull job, and the quarantine folder for malformed files. Review comments on the retry logic should still go through the normal PR flow, but questions about drop-folder conventions or partner onboarding now go to the new owner. The incoming owner is listed below.

signatory, tagaf-bahaf: Praael Fenmir Rusok

Meeting notes — Brindlepay retries working group

Discussed idempotency keys for payment retries in the Brindlepay gateway. Agreed: keys generated client-side per attempt chain, stored 48 hours, duplicate requests return the original response body with a replay header. Reviewer should check key scoping per merchant and the TTL eviction path. Open question on batch refunds deferred to next week. Final approval on the design doc rests with the person named below.

named custodian: Brivan Eliath Quenox Frador

## Transcode farm: stuck job triage

If a customer reports a video stuck in "processing" on Reelbarrow for over an hour, odds are a worker died mid-job. Check the farm dashboard first, then requeue from the jobs table — don't just restart the worker. The jobs table lives in the farm database, reachable with this connection string.

replica DSN, kajep-yahag: mssql://praok_svc:iF@db-8d68.plorvaio.local:5432/eliion